Many people don’t immediately think of Missouri when it comes to vacation destinations, but it is. Missouri is home to one of America’s favorite cities, St. Louis, where the famous Gateway Arch can whisk you up to more than 600 feet over the Mississippi River for a spectacular view. In the city you’ll find one-of-a-kind dining experiences, the Anheuser-Busch Brewery, riverboat casinos, and as the birthplace of the Blues, plenty of nightlife. After a night of excitement, try a leisurely stroll through Forest Lake’s Park or the charming Missouri Botanical Gardens. Or if you just want to get away, Missouri has numerous state parks, rivers, and caves to explore. Popular sports include rafting down sparkling rivers, fishing, golf, hiking the Ozark Trail, and cycling the 225-mile long path through Katy Trail State Park. Horseback riding is also permitted on certain portions of the trail. For those that can’t find enough to do above ground, Missouri also has over 6,200 caves throughout the state. The state of Missouri is home to one of America’s favorite cities, St. Louis. Here vistors will find the Gateway Arch where you can ride more than 600 feet over the Mississippi River for a spectacular view of the city and its surroundings. In the city visitors will find one-of-a-kind dining experiences, the Anheuser-Busch Brewery, riverboat casinos, and ample nightlife, including, of course, plenty of live entertainment considering it is the birthplace of the Blues. After a night of excitement, a leisurely stroll through the newly landscaped Forest Lake’s Park or the charming Missouri Botanical Gardens is bound to help anyone relax and recooperate, as will a scenic drive along the historic Route 66. Or for those who just want to get away from it all, there’s more to Missouri than St. Louis alone. With numerous state parks, rivers, and caves throughout the state, visitors will find many chances for outdoor fun. Popular sports include canoeing, rafting, kayaking, or tubing in sparkling rivers, fishing in Missouri’s streams and lakes, golf, hiking the Ozark Trail, and cycling. In fact, cyclists will find particular delight in touring along the 225-mile long, hard-packed gravel path that winds through Katy Trail State Park. Horseback riders can also use portions of the path for equestrian pursuits. For those that can’t find enough to do above ground, Missouri also has over 6,200 unique and colorful caves throughout the state.
